Obama still leading in most swing state polls


A new crop of polls found that Obama is up in most of the battleground states

BY JILLIAN RAYFIELD

Mitt Romney has made some gains in the polls following his debate win, but he appears to still be trailing overall. Here are some of the latest numbers:

In Michigan: Obama leads 46-44 percent according to Gravis.

In Ohio: Obama leads 51-45 percent according to an NBC/WSJ/Marist poll; Obama leads 47-46 according to Pulse Opinion Research, Obama leads 48-47 according to Rasmussen.

In Virginia: Romney leads 48-47 percent, according to NBC/WSJ/Marist; Obama leads 51-46 percent, according to CBS/NYT/Quinnipiac; Obama and Romney are tied at 48 percent, according to Pulse Opinion Research.

In Colorado: Romney leads 48 -47 percent, according to a CBS/NYT/Quinnipiac poll.

In Wisconsin: Obama leads 50-47 percent, according to CBS/NYT/Quinnipiac; Obama leads 50-46 percent, according to Pulse Opinion Research.

In Florida: Obama leads 47-46 percent, according to NBC/WSJ/Marist.
In Pennsylvania: Obama leads 47-45 percent, according to Pulse Opinion Research
